    Tax breaks available for Online Educational centers in US?
    I am in the middle of a startup and would like to know what sort of tax breaks are available to my company (which is an online educational institution) and what states? I am based in US.

  • Dec 17, 2015, 08:15 AM
    joypulv
    You don't get any Federal tax breaks, other than easily declaring a loss for the first 5 years. I'm not sure why you would have centers, plural. It's online. You aren't paying sales tax to the buyer's state.
    Operate out of the state you are in. My state, a northern state, like many northern states, gives tax breaks because businesses have left the state. Each state has different incentives that change a lot.
